2.3.3 Reaction to network communication faults

2.3.4 Node guarding

Festo P.BE-CTEU-CO-OP+MAINT-EN en 1101NH
Note
Please observe the following if the outputs are reset in the
event of a PLC stop or field bus interruption or
malfunction:
– Single-solenoid valves move to the basic position.
– Double-solenoid valves remain in the current position.
– Mid-position valves move to the mid position (depending
on the valve type: pressurised, exhausted or blocked).
You can parameterise the behaviour of connected devices in
the event of a fault. All valves/outputs of connected devices
are reset as standard when the following faults and operating
states occur as soon as Node guarding or Heartbeat are activ-
ated via the configuration:
Communication error (Node guarding, Heartbeat)
Transition from operational to pre-operational or stopped
The behaviour of connected devices in the event of commu-
nication errors can be changed using the corresponding DIL
switches (see section 1.7).
In order for CANopen to recognise a fieldbus failure Node
guarding must be activated on the master controller (default:
switched off ).
In the case of actuators it is advisable to monitor the master
controller for failure in order to provide an appropriate emer-
gency shutdown strategy.
